The ability to prevent an unwanted SMS from reaching a mobile device running the Android operating system is a core function. This feature allows users to control incoming communications and mitigate potential harassment or spam. Blocking a phone number effectively stops future text messages from that specific sender from appearing in the user’s inbox.
Controlling incoming communications offers several benefits, including reduced distractions, increased privacy, and protection from unwanted solicitations. The ability to prevent contact is particularly crucial in addressing harassment or stalking. Functionality has evolved from rudimentary blocking mechanisms to more sophisticated filtering options within modern Android OS versions, reflecting a growing user demand for control over their digital interactions.
